The Ridge High School varsity hockey team traveled to Union meet the Watchung Hills Warriors for their second game of the season. The Devils tried hard, but ultimately were unable to take away their first winning game of the season, leaving the ice with a 2-2 tie.
| 1st | 2nd | 3rd | FINAL | |
| Ridge (0-1-1) | 1 | 1 | 0 | 2 |
| Watchung Hills (0-1-1) | 0 | 1 | 1 | 2 |
IN SHORT
Ridge opened up the scoring with goals from captains Tom Carpenter in the first period and Keith Knapp in the second both assisted by Chris Mastroianni. But Watchung Hills, always tough against Ridge, came back with an unassisted goal by Sean Simons just 45 seconds after Knapp's. With only 6:47 remaining in the game, Ryan Charko scored an assisted goal to tie the game for the Warriors.
DEVIL OF THE GAME
Chris Mastroianni — Chris had assists on both Ridge goals and was ever active in the offense.
OTHER KEY PERFORMANCES
Robbie Fenton — Fenton had 17 saves on 19 shots in the goal for the Devils.
THEY SAID IT
"It was a good game. A tie on the road is always good. We had some chances in the 3rd period, but they didn't go in. It is always like this in the Skylands conference games," Ridge coach Tim Mullin, Sr.
THE 2011-12 RED DEVIL HOCKEY TEAM
"This years' squad returns all our starters from 2011 with the loss of 2 defensemen and our goalie," said coach Tim Mullin, Sr. "We were young last year," Mullin added.
WHO TO LOOK FOR THIS SEASON
Robbie Fenton, junior goalie — "I expect Fenton to step up in the goal and show us what he's got," said Mullin.
THE CAPTAINS
The Red Devils will be led by returning seniors forwards Tommy Carpenter and Keith Knapp, and defenseman, Derek Vogt.
"We are really looking for goalie (Robbie) Fenton to step up this year," said Tommy Carpenter. "There is a lot of scoring coming back and some solid "D" players too," added Keith Knapp. "We are really deep this year with three solid lines," said Derek Vogt.
